Creecy advises matrics to attend SSIP classes

Matric winter classes key to good results.

MEC for Education Barbara Creecy has congratulated pupils who are attending extra classes during the April school holidays.

She assured that their sacrifices now would reward them when the matric results are announced in January next year.

“I know no one wants to give up their holidays and attend extra classes,” said Creecy.

She also said that pupils who do well and achieve a university pass and even succeed in getting a bursary for their further studies are pupils who attend SSIP classes on a regular basis.

“In fact I will go so far as to say that if you attend each and every SSIP class I can guarantee that you will pass matric,” she said.

MEC Creecy also stressed that there is no substitute for hard work. In order to get good results at the end of the year, the work has to start now.

Creecy pointed out that putting in the effort early will mean less pressure in October when pupils prepare to write their final examinations.

Extra classes for the 2014 matrics will run throughout this week.

According to the department of education once term starts extra classes will be held every Saturday. Programmes will also run during the June holidays as well as the September vacation.

Subjects targeted are: Maths; Maths Literacy; Physical Science; Life Sciences; Accounting; English First Additional Language; Economics, Business Studies; History and Geography.
